Our Odyssey of the Mind program started this week! We have 11 incredible students that are excited to think 'outside the box', problem solving through teamwork and collaboration.
Odyssey of the Mind is a creative problem-solving competition for students. Teams of students select a problem, create a solution, then present their solution in a competition against other teams. For our regional competition in February, we will be competing against other schools within Allegany county.
